Tổng hợp chi phí data transfer trên AWS

Tổng hợp chi phí data transfer trên AWS

avatar

Minh Bui

2024.07.23

Bài viết này sẽ chia sẻ các loại chi phí phát sinh liên quan đến data transfer trên môi trường AWS.

Introduction

Khi sử dụng các AWS service thì ngoài chi phí sử dụng dịch vụ đó ra thì mình sẽ tốn thêm cả chi phí cho data đi ra và đi vào các service đó nữa, cái này gọi là data transfer cost. Bài viết này sẽ giúp các bạn có một cái nhìn tốt hơn về cách thức tính chi phí data transfer trên môi trường aws. Lưu ý: Chi phí trong sẽ lấy giá của region tokyo (ap-northeast-1) tại thời điểm viết bài.

Data transfer cost ở đây mình sẽ phân ra làm 3 loại chính:

  • Inbound cost: Chi phí cho data đi vào môi trường aws
  • Outbound cost: Chi phí cho data đi ra khỏi môi trường aws
  • Internal cost: Chi phí cho data di chuyển giữa các region, az bên trong môi trường aws

1. Chi phí inbound cost và ví dụ

Về cơ bản là data từ bên ngoài đi vào môi trường aws là miễn phí, tuy nhiên cũng có một số service có cơ chế tính tiền dựa trên lượng data đi vào nó, ví dụ như ELB, NatGW, v.v..

1.1. Internet → EC2

Free

1.2. Internet → ALB → EC2

Các loại chi phí phát sinh:

  • Chi phí sử dụng ALB: 0.0243$/h
  • Chi phí data đi qua ALB: 0.008$/LCU

Tham khảo: https://aws.amazon.com/elasticloadbalancing/pricing/

1.2. Internet → NLB → EC2

Các loại chi phí phát sinh:

  • Chi phí sử dụng NLB: 0.0243$/h
  • Chi phí data đi qua NLB: 0.006$/NLCU
  • Chi phí data transfer cross zone nếu NLB và EC2 khác AZ: 0.01$/GB/Chiều

Tham khảo: https://aws.amazon.com/elasticloadbalancing/pricing/

1.3. On-premise → VPN → EC2

Các loại chi phí phát sinh:

  • Phí sử dụng VPN: 0.048$/h

Tham khảo: https://aws.amazon.com/vpn/pricing/

1.4. On-premise → VPN → TGW → EC2

Các loại chi phí phát sinh:

  • Phí sử dụng VPN: 0.048$/h
  • Phí sử dụng TGW: 0.05$/TGW attachment
  • Phí data đi qua TGW: 0.02$/GB

Tham khảo:

1.5. On-premise → DX → EC2

Các loại chi phí phát sinh:

  • Phí sử dụng DX, ví dụ:
    • Băng thông 1Gbps: 0.285$/h
    • Băng thông 10Gbps: 2.142$/h
    • * Giá tiền sẽ thay đổi dựa trên nhiều loại hình thuê DX

Tham khảo: https://aws.amazon.com/directconnect/pricing/

1.6. On-premise → DX → TGW → EC2

Các loại chi phí phát sinh:

  • Phí sử dụng DX, ví dụ:
    • Băng thông 1Gbps: 0.285$/h
    • Băng thông 10Gbps: 2.142$/h
    • * Giá tiền sẽ thay đổi dựa trên nhiều loại hình thuê DX
  • Phí sử dụng TGW: 0.05$/TGW attachment
  • Phí data đi qua TGW: 0.02$/GB

Tham khảo:

2. Chi phí outbound cost và ví dụ

Về cơ bản là data từ bên trong môi trường aws đi ra sẽ đều bị tính phí, tham khảo các ví dụ sau

2.1. EC2 → Internet

Các loại chi phí phát sinh:

  • Phí data transfer to internet:
    • 1GB đầu tiên free
    • 10TB đầu tiên: 0.114$/GB
    • 40TB tiếp theo: 0.089$/GB
    • 100TB tiếp theo: 0.086$/GB
    • Từ 150TB trở đi: 0.084$/GB

Tham khảo:

2.2. EC2 → NAT GW → Internet

Các loại chi phí phát sinh:

  • Phí sử dụng VPN: 0.048$/h
  • Phí data transfer to internet:
    • 1GB đầu tiên free
    • 10TB đầu tiên: 0.114$/GB
    • 40TB tiếp theo: 0.089$/GB
    • 100TB tiếp theo: 0.086$/GB
    • Từ 150TB trở đi: 0.084$/GB

Tham khảo:

2.3. EC2 → VPN → On-premise

Các loại chi phí phát sinh:

  • Phí data transfer to internet:
    • 1GB đầu tiên free
    • 10TB đầu tiên: 0.114$/GB
    • 40TB tiếp theo: 0.089$/GB
    • 100TB tiếp theo: 0.086$/GB
    • Từ 150TB trở đi: 0.084$/GB
  • Phí sử dụng VPN: 0.048$/h

Tham khảo:

2.4. EC2 → DX → On-premise

Các loại chi phí phát sinh:

  • Phí sử dụng DX, ví dụ:
    • Băng thông 1Gbps: 0.285$/h
    • Băng thông 10Gbps: 2.142$/h
    • * Giá tiền sẽ thay đổi dựa trên nhiều loại hình thuê DX
  • Phí data đi qua direct connect: 0.0410$/h

Tham khảo:

2.5. EC2 → TGW → VPN → On-premise

Các loại chi phí phát sinh:

  • Phí data transfer to internet:
    • 1GB đầu tiên free
    • 10TB đầu tiên: 0.114$/GB
    • 40TB tiếp theo: 0.089$/GB
    • 100TB tiếp theo: 0.086$/GB
    • Từ 150TB trở đi: 0.084$/GB
  • Phí sử dụng VPN: 0.048$/h
  • Phí sử dụng TGW: 0.05$/TGW attachment
  • Phí data đi qua TGW: 0.02$/GB

Tham khảo:

2.5. EC2 → TGW → DX → On-premise

Các loại chi phí phát sinh:

  • Phí sử dụng DX, ví dụ:
    • Băng thông 1Gbps: 0.285$/h
    • Băng thông 10Gbps: 2.142$/h
    • * Giá tiền sẽ thay đổi dựa trên nhiều loại hình thuê DX
  • Phí data đi qua direct connect: 0.0410$/h
  • Phí sử dụng TGW: 0.05$/TGW attachment
  • Phí data đi qua TGW: 0.02$/GB

Tham khảo:

3. Chi phí internal cost và ví dụ

3.1. Data transfer cùng AZ trong cùng Region

Free

3.2. Data transfer khác AZ trong cùng Region

Các loại chi phí phát sinh:

  • Phí data transfer cross az: 0.01$/GB

Tham khảo:

Tuy nhiên vẫn có ngoại lệ, ví dụ RDS Multi AZ

3.3. Data transfer qua VPC Interface Endpoint đến service trong cùng region

Các loại chi phí phát sinh:

  • Phí VPC Endpoint: 0.014$/h
  • Phí data đi qua VPC Endpoint: 0.01$/GB
    • 1PB đầu tiên: 0.01$/GB
    • 4PB tiếp theo: 0.006$/GB
    • Từ 5PB trở đi: 0.004$/GB

Tham khảo:

3.4. Data transfer qua VPC Gateway Endpoint đến service trong cùng region

Free

Tổng kết

Như vậy là vừa rồi mình đã chia sẻ về các loại chi phí phát sinh liên quan đến data transfer trên aws, mong là sẽ giúp ích được nhiều cho các bạn, để từ đó có thể estimate và làm báo giá cho khách hàng được chính xác hơn. Nếu bài viết có thiếu sót hay cần bổ sung, hoặc cần giải đáp thắc mắc, hãy liên hệ Cloud mentor pro.